Recommended list of varieties

The recommended list for agricultural crops contains a selection of varieties of arable and fodder plants which are considered important for cultivation in the Netherlands. These varieties have been extensively tested for VCU. The results are described in the list of varieties. Based on this information, growers can make a conscious choice for the varieties best suited to their particular growing conditions.
 
The recommended list is published by the Commissie Samenstelling Aanbevelende Rassenlijst (CSAR), an independent foundation whose board comprises representatives from the Product Board Arable Products, LTO Nederland and Plantum.
 
The recommended list is published under the responsibility of CSAR and is published in two editions:
